Whitewash refers to a type of paint made from lime, water, and other additives, commonly used for painting walls, fences, and other surfaces. While traditionally associated with its white color, whitewash can also be tinted to various shades to suit different aesthetic preferences. Beyond its decorative purposes, whitewash is valued for its protective and insulating properties, as well as its eco-friendly characteristics. 1. Composition and Ingredients

Whitewash is primarily composed of lime (calcium hydroxide), water, and additives such as salt, glue, or pigment for coloration. The lime is derived from limestone and undergoes a chemical reaction with water to form calcium hydroxide, which serves as the main binding agent in the paint. Additives like salt or glue may be included to improve adhesion, durability, or weather resistance, while pigments can be added to tint the whitewash to desired colors.

2. Historical and Cultural Significance

Whitewash has a long history dating back thousands of years, with evidence of its use found in ancient civilizations such as the Egyptians, Greeks, and Romans. It has been used for a variety of purposes, including painting buildings, fences, and agricultural structures, as well as for artistic and decorative applications. Whitewash also holds cultural significance in many regions, symbolizing purity, cleanliness, and simplicity.

3. Environmental Impact

While whitewash is often touted as an eco-friendly alternative to conventional paints, its environmental impact is not without considerations. The production of lime, a key ingredient in whitewash, typically involves the high-temperature calcination of limestone, which emits carbon dioxide (CO2) into the atmosphere, contributing to greenhouse gas emissions. Additionally, whitewash may contain additives or pigments that can be harmful to the environment if not properly managed.

4. Sustainable and Eco-Friendly Characteristics

Despite its environmental impact, whitewash offers several sustainable and eco-friendly characteristics that make it an attractive option for environmentally conscious consumers. Whitewash is biodegradable and non-toxic, making it safer for both humans and the environment compared to many synthetic paints. It also has natural antimicrobial properties, inhibiting the growth of mold and mildew on painted surfaces, which can contribute to improved indoor air quality.

5. Versatility and Applications

Whitewash is a versatile paint that can be applied to a wide range of surfaces, including masonry, wood, metal, and even fabric. It is commonly used for painting walls, ceilings, fences, barns, and other outdoor structures due to its durability and weather resistance. Whitewash can also be used for artistic and decorative purposes, such as creating textured or distressed finishes, murals, or faux finishes that mimic the look of aged or weathered surfaces.

6. Application and Techniques

Applying whitewash requires specific techniques to achieve desired results and ensure proper adhesion and coverage. The surface to be painted must be clean, dry, and free of debris, with any loose or flaking paint removed. Whitewash is typically applied in thin coats using a brush, roller, or sprayer, with each coat allowed to dry before applying the next. Multiple coats may be necessary to achieve the desired opacity and coverage, especially on porous surfaces.

7. Maintenance and Longevity

Proper maintenance is essential for maximizing the longevity and durability of whitewash finishes. While whitewash is known for its weather resistance, it may require periodic touch-ups or recoating to maintain its appearance and protective properties, especially in outdoor environments exposed to harsh weather conditions. Regular cleaning with a mild detergent and water can help remove dirt, dust, and other debris that may accumulate on painted surfaces, prolonging the life of the whitewash finish.

8. Health and Safety Considerations

While whitewash is generally considered safe and non-toxic, it is important to take appropriate precautions when handling and applying the paint. Lime, a primary ingredient in whitewash, can be caustic and may cause skin irritation or burns upon contact. Protective clothing, gloves, and eyewear should be worn when working with whitewash to minimize the risk of skin or eye irritation. Proper ventilation is also important when applying whitewash indoors to prevent inhalation of fumes or dust particles.

10. Sustainable Practices and Alternatives

As environmental awareness continues to grow, there is increasing interest in exploring sustainable alternatives to traditional whitewash and other paint products. Some manufacturers offer eco-friendly whitewash formulations that use low-impact or recycled materials and minimize the carbon footprint associated with production. Additionally, there is a growing trend towards using natural, plant-based paints and finishes made from ingredients such as clay, earth pigments, and natural oils, which offer similar aesthetic and performance qualities to whitewash while further reducing environmental impact.
